John Charles "Coley" Luttrell was born in 1876 in Iuka, Tishomingo County, United States of America, the child of Mathew Madison Luttrell And Artie Melissa Cobb. In 1880, John Charles "Coley" Luttrell resided in Alcorn, Mississippi, USA. John Charles "Coley" Luttrell married Carrie Luttrell, and had children including Cassie Luttrell, Jackson Luttrell, Rene Luttrell, Simon Luttrell, Walter Luttrell. John Charles "Coley" Luttrell passed away in 1962 in Hughes, St. Francis County, Arkansas, United States of America.
